Shared Memory settings recently used the shmget function, and found that the returned value is-1, and the perror result is Invalid argument www.2cto.com. It turned out that the shared memory value was too large, after Ubuntu is installed, the maximum shared memory size is 32 MB by default. There are two ways to set the shared memory: 1. permanently set www.2cto.com a) at/etc/sysctl. add a kernel in the conf file. shmmax = 0x40000000 (set the shared memory to 1 GB) B) Restart system 2. temporary settings a) modify the file/proc/sys/kernel/shmmax and change the value to 1073741824 (the system will expire after restart)
